The word 'drought' is the correct answer because it contains the diphthong /aʊ/, matching 'bough'.
The word 'bough' is phonetically transcribed as /baʊ/, featuring the diphthong /aʊ/. Among the given choices, 'drought' (/draʊt/) is the only word that shares this exact diphthong sound.
